Foo Fighters Share Video For New Single Shame Shame

Tuesday, 10 November 2020 Written by Laura Johnson

Photo: Danny Clinch

Foo Fighters have shared a video for Shame Shame.

The single is the first to be taken from their new album, 'Medicine At Midnight', which they recently revealed is due for release on February 5.

The Paola Kudacki-directed clip finds frontman Dave Grohl recreating a recurring childhood dream while interacting with actress and model Sofia Boutella, who delivers a mesmerising performance as she embodies the subject matter of the song. 

Alongside the video, the band have announced a livestream show from the Roxy in Los Angeles on November 14. Tickets are $15 and can be bought here. A portion of the proceeds from the event will go to the Sweet Relief Musicians Fund.

The rockers also recently put out the 'Live On the Radio 1996' EP, and earlier this year were forced to cancel their 25th anniversary The Van Tour ​due to the ongoing coronavirus pandemic.
